Trump says ‘very close’ on Gaza peace plan deal
  Date : 08-10-2025

As we’ve been reporting, indirect negotiations between Israeli and Hamas delegations have concluded for today in Sharm el-Sheikh, Egypt.

The talks are based on a 20-point plan proposed by Trump to end the war.

“There’s a real chance that we could do something,” Trump told reporters earlier. “I think there’s a possibility that we could have peace in the Middle East.”


Trump said the US would do “everything possible to make sure everyone adheres to the deal” if Hamas and Israel do agree on a ceasefire, although he did not elaborate.
